Battle of the superapps: GoTo vs Sea in Indonesia

Inside Retail

But by the end of 2021, the squeeze was well and truly on, with Tokopedia at 39 per cent and Shopee at 34 per cent. Shopee, which is number one in the six other South-east Asian markets in which it operates, arrived in Indonesia in 2015, which was six years after the launch of Tokopedia. Singapore-based Grab was a distant third.
